@@ -167,10 +167,19 @@ jobs:
167167 echo "Prepare workflow environment variables"
168168 echo 'export BRANCH="$SELENIUM_VERSION"' >> $BASH_ENV
169169 echo 'export GITHUB_REPO="$CIRCLE_PROJECT_REPONAME"' >> $BASH_ENV
170- echo 'export GITHUB_USER="CIRCLE_PROJECT_USERNAME"' >> $BASH_ENV
170+ echo 'export GITHUB_USER="$ CIRCLE_PROJECT_USERNAME"' >> $BASH_ENV
171171 echo 'export BUILD_DATE=$(date '+%Y%m%d')' >> $BASH_ENV
172- echo 'export RELEASE_TAG=seleniarm-v"$BRANCH"-"$BUILD_DATE"' >> $BASH_ENV
172+ echo 'export RELEASE_TAG=" seleniarm-v"`echo $BRANCH` "-"`echo $BUILD_DATE` "' >> $BASH_ENV
173173 source $BASH_ENV
174+ echo "Workflow environment variables:"
175+ echo BRANCH="$BRANCH"
176+ echo GITHUB_REPO="$GITHUB_REPO"
177+ echo GITHUB_USER="$GITHUB_USER"
178+ echo BUILD_DATE="$BUILD_DATE"
179+ echo RELEASE_TAG="$RELEASE_TAG"
180+ echo PLATFORMS="$PLATFORMS"
181+ echo BUILD_ARGS="$BUILD_ARGS"
182+ echo DEPLOY_BRANCH="$DEPLOY_BRANCH"
174183 - checkout
175184 - run : uname -a
176185 - run : docker info
@@ -196,9 +205,6 @@ jobs:
196205 command : |
197206 echo "Login to Docker, and setup to use a buildx builder and push built multi-arch images"
198207 docker buildx use `docker buildx create`
199- #echo 'export BUILD_DATE=$(date '+%Y%m%d')' >> $BASH_ENV
200- #echo 'export BRANCH=4.1.3' >> $BASH_ENV # find a better place to control this.
201- echo BRANCH="$BRANCH"
202208 docker buildx ls
203209 docker login -u="$DOCKER_USERNAME" -p="$DOCKER_PASSWORD"
204210 NAME=${NAMESPACE} VERSION=${BRANCH} BUILD_DATE=${BUILD_DATE} PLATFORMS=${PLATFORMS} BUILD_ARGS=${BUILD_ARGS} make build_multi
0 commit comments